Description
The MCP1256, MCP1257, MCP1258 and MCP1259
are inductorless, positive regulated charge pump
DC/DC converters. The devices generate a regulated
3.3V output voltage from a 1.8V to 3.6V input. The
devices are specifically designed for applications
operating from 2-cell alkaline, Ni-Cd, or Ni-MH
batteries or by one primary lithium MnO2 (or similar)
coin cell battery. 
The MCP1256, MCP1257, MCP1258 and MCP1259
provide high efficiency by automatically switching
between 1.5x and 2x boost operation. In addition, at
light output loads, the MCP1256 and MCP1257 can be
placed in a SLEEP mode, lowering the quiescent
current while maintaining the regulated output voltage.
Alternatively, the MCP1258 and MCP1259 provide a
BYPASS feature connecting the input voltage to the
output. This allows for real-time clocks,
microcontrollers or other system devices to remain
biased with virtually no current being consumed by the
MCP1258 or MPC1259.
In normal operation, the output voltage ripple is below
20 mV
PP
 at load currents up to 100 mA. Normal opera-
tion occurs at a fixed switching frequency of 650 kHz,
avoiding interference with sensitive IF bands.
The MCP1256 and MCP1258 feature a power-good
output that can be used to detect out-of-regulation
conditions. The MCP1257 and MCP1259 feature a low-
battery indication that issues a warning if the input
voltage drops below a preset voltage threshold.
Extremely low supply current and few external parts (4
capacitors) make these devices ideal for small, battery-
powered applications. A Shutdown mode is also
provided for further power reduction. 
The devices incorporate thermal and short-circuit pro-
tection. Two package offerings are provided: 10-pin
MSOP and 10-lead 3 mm x 3 mm DFN. The devices
are completely characterized over the junction temper-
ature range of -40°C to +125°C.
